Number Filter visualisation like text filter visualisation

Hi ,

 

I have requirement to apply a "Number filter" like we have "Text filter" optoin in power bi desktop to directly pass the number manually. As the client is much familiar with invoice numbers he is dealing with.

I'm having the same issue. It seems number fields cant be used with the text filters search box.

You could create a new column and cast the number as text and use that,

That's the best solution but to make it work on Direct Query dashboards, in which you're not allowed to use CONVERT,FORMAT or CAST functions, you can use this workaround.

Create a new column like this = CONCATENATE("", [your_int_field]) and bind the Text Filter component to that column.
